Project Manager & Product OwnerRole Overview

The Project Manager (PMPO) is the primary point of contact for clients and works closely in tandem with our Developers and Designers to successfully deliver products that provide exceptional business value to our clients and their users. APMs are often responsible for managing several concurrent, complex, enterprise-level projects in a fast-paced environment that may cross multiple business divisions. In performing this role, the APM is expected to blend traditional project management principles with Agile development practices to motivate team members, manage client expectations, maintain project contracts, and ensure all project timelines, deliverables and budgets are met.

ResponsibilitiesProject Planning and Management

  • Organize and lead all project status meetings and exercises to support project performance in terms of scope, timeline, budget and deliverables. Drive course corrections to maintain alignment with client needs.
  • Support project needs through facilitation of all client and stakeholder communication, including managing and resetting expectations as needed, and through the use of effective systems for project governance.
  • Act as mediator to resolve all conflicting client and internal team needs in order to ensure optimal resolutions and compromises for involved parties in all instances.
  • Evaluate all projects and agreements for risks and potential threats to client satisfaction, project success and Caxy profitability.
  • Maintain ownership of client relationships and contracts. Develop a comprehensive understanding of all client needs and agreements.
  • Prepare and distribute internal as well as client facing project progress reports, documentation, proposals and presentation materials.
  • Support accounting needs for project invoicing through oversight and reporting on hours billed on projects.
  • Identify opportunities for additional/new project work with clients, and facilitate project expansion or strategy shifts in alignment with Caxy and client interests.
  • Other tasks and responsibilities as requested.

Process Management and Improvement

  • Manage all projects in alignment with Agile and SCRUM strategies and provide organizational support frameworks as well as clear communication routes to meet all client and internal team needs on a project by project basis.

Team Support and Oversight

  • Manage and support cross-functional project teams with 3+ team members including Developers, Designers, Copywriters, QA Personnel, and Business Analysts.
  • Promote empowerment of each project team and ensure that all members are fully engaged in the project and making meaningful contributions. 
  • Identify and encourage a sustainable pace for the team to maintain while delivering high quality work.
  • Support and assist with team development and individual performance assessments.

Desired Candidate Qualities

  • A passion for agile project management practices, open source values, collaboration and satisfied clients.
  • A strong dedication to teamwork centered strategies that value group success over individual accolades and personal performance metrics.
  • A genuine desire for continual learning and professional growth.
  • Strong analytical, planning, and organizational skills as well as an ability to balance competing demands and focus on multiple, varied topics at a time.
  • A creative approach to problem-solving with the ability to focus on details and break concepts down into actionable steps while always maintaining the “big picture” view. We’re always looking for innovative ideas, and solutions for quandaries new and old.
  • Excellent oral and written communications skills, and an ability to easily interact with both business and IT individuals at all levels, from entry up through executive.
  • Strong interpersonal skills and an interest in mentoring, coaching, collaborating, and team building.
  • An ability to consistently, accurately and objectively evaluate complex project risks and issues.
  • An active participant in relevant communities and support networks.


Core Competencies 

  • Proficient at managing complex projects with past experience working in a high-tech development environment with cross-functional teams. PMP certification preferred.
  • Proficient in SCRUM/Agile methodologies with past experience implementing them on enterprise-level application development projects. PMI-ACP, CSM, or equivalent preferred.
  • Proficient at leveraging organizational resources and strategies to improve capacity for project work.
  • Proficient at establishing and maintaining strong business relationships with clients and peers based on mutual trust and confidence.
  • Proficient understanding of software development life cycle models.
  • Competent at working with project management tools designed to support software and application development like JIRA, Codebase, Rally, VersionOne or equivalent (we currently run JIRA).
  • Competent at working with basic business support applications and products like Google Home & Office products, MS Office/Project/Visio.

Requirements

  • Experience managing multiple technical projects in a fast-paced environment (in an agency is a bonus)
  • Availability to work onsite at the Caxy offices during our regular business hours.
  • Ability to work within a team environment as well as independently as needed.

How does the company support your career growth?

We support growth informally through peer learning, project stretch skills, exposure to new technology, and a broad range of business verticals. We support growth formally through professional development plans, pair learning partners, semi-annual reviews, weekly or monthly check-ins toward goals, and opportunities to take classes / conferences.

How do your team's ideas influence the company's direction?

The technologies Caxy works in is constantly being evaluated and updated. We do a "State of the Stack" twice a year where we talk about the new things we're focusing on.
